Walk on 2000-year-old Roman streets underground — right beneath the Gothic Quarter
Barcelona's most fascinating museum takes you through the centuries to the very foundations of Roman Barcino. You'll stroll over ruins of the old streets, sewers, laundries and wine-and-fish-making factories that flourished here following the town's founding by Emperor Augustus around 10 BC. The building itself was once part of the Palau Reial Major — the Grand Royal Palace.
